Subject: Sort stability in Gridloom reports

Welcome to the rotation. Quick note for plugin authors you'll field questions from: the Gridloom report builder uses a stable sort only when a tiebreaker column is declared. Without one, row order between runs is undefined — not a bug, don't file it. Plugins should always set a tiebreaker. The full ordering contract and examples are on the page below.

operations page: https://jenkins.zemvarcloud.local/job/merge_requests/repo/build/73930b4b30f0a8ed

## Releases

Spoolhawk releases are cut from the `stable` branch every second Tuesday. Each build of the spooler service is tagged, archived, and signed before it reaches the Quillford artifact mirror. Verify the tarball checksum before promoting to production, and never skip the signature step even for hotfixes. The public signing key used to verify all Spoolhawk release artifacts is as follows.

rollout seal: bky9_PeXH1fTLY

Subject: DR Drill Results — Admin Dashboard Theme Service

Hi,

Summary from Tuesday's disaster-recovery drill for the Opalboard admin dashboard. Failover to the secondary region completed in nine minutes. One finding relevant to the release: the dark-mode preference service did not restore user theme settings automatically, so all admins were reverted to light mode until the settings vault was manually unlocked. Please note this in the release checklist. To unlock the settings vault during a real event, use the passphrase below.

unlock words, hahip-yagef: zorok-novmir-zorix-silax